The interesting thing about Golden Week is that they are just a few scattered national holidays that don't really consist of a whole week of vacation. May 2nd is not actually holiday, but my company is forcing everyone to take paid vacation on that day. The thing is, people don't take work off to do things, so I think that most employees appreciate being forced to take a holiday because that means it's ok.
